Why Dog Food for Excessive Shedding Is Necessary
I’ve learned that excessive shedding is often more than just a normal part of having a dog. When my dog started shedding more than usual, I realized that the food I was giving him could be affecting his coat and skin health. Dog food made for excessive shedding is necessary because it usually contains better-quality proteins, om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ids, and key vitamins that help support a healthier coat from the inside out.
My experience taught me that poor nutrition can show up quickly in a dog’s fur. If a dog isn’t getting the right nutrients, the coat can become dry, brittle, and more likely to fall out. Choosing food designed to reduce shedding can help strengthen the skin barrier, improve coat shine, and make grooming much easier for me.
I also found that this kind of dog food can be helpful in spotting bigger health issues. If my dog is still shedding heavily even after switching to a better diet, it may be a sign of allergies, stress, or an underlying medical problem. So for me, dog food for excessive shedding is not just about cleanliness—it’s about helping my dog stay healthier and more comfortable overall.
My Buying Guides on Dog Food For Excessive Shedding
When I started looking for dog food to help with excessive shedding, I quickly realized that not every formula is created equal. In my experience, the right food can make a noticeable difference in coat health, skin comfort, and overall shedding. Here’s what I personally look for when choosing the best dog food for a shedding dog.
1. I Look for High-Quality Animal Protein
Protein is the foundation of a healthy coat. I always check that the first ingredient is a real animal protein like chicken, salmon, turkey, lamb, or beef. My dog’s coat improved when I switched to food with better protein sources because hair growth and skin repair depend on it.
2. I Choose Foods Rich in Omega-3 and Omega-6 Fatty Acids
In my experience, fatty acids are one of the most important things for reducing excessive shedding. I look for ingredients like fish oil, salmon oil, flaxseed, and chicken fat. These help support skin moisture and give my dog a shinier, healthier coat.
3. I Avoid Foods with Too Many Fillers
I try to stay away from dog foods that are packed with corn, wheat, soy, and artificial additives. These ingredients don’t usually help coat health and, for some dogs, they can even trigger skin irritation or allergies that make shedding worse.
4. I Check for Skin-Friendly Vitamins and Minerals
I always look for vitamins like A, E, and B-complex, along with minerals such as zinc and biotin. From my experience, these nutrients support healthy skin and stronger fur, which can help reduce breakage and constant shedding.
5. I Consider My Dog’s Possible Food Sensitivities
If my dog is shedding excessively, I also think about whether food allergies might be part of the problem. I’ve found that limited-ingredient or grain-free formulas can help some dogs, especially if they have itchy skin, redness, or digestive issues along with shedding.
6. I Match the Food to My Dog’s Age and Size
I make sure the food fits my dog’s life stage and breed size. Puppies, adults, and seniors all have different nutritional needs, and large breeds may need different support than small breeds. The right formula helps me give my dog balanced nutrition for skin and coat health.
7. I Look for Good Digestibility
When a food is easy to digest, my dog seems to absorb nutrients better. I prefer formulas with quality ingredients and probiotics or prebiotic fiber when available. Better digestion often means better skin and coat condition in my experience.
8. I Read Reviews and Watch for Real Results
I always check reviews from other dog owners who mention coat improvement or reduced shedding. While every dog is different, I find it helpful to see whether a food has worked for others with similar issues.
9. I Don’t Expect Instant Results
One thing I’ve learned is that coat improvement takes time. Even with the best food, I usually wait several weeks before expecting to see less shedding. I stay consistent and monitor changes in my dog’s coat, skin, and energy.
Final Thoughts
For me, the best dog food for excessive shedding is one that supports skin health, provides quality protein, includes healthy fats, and avoids unnecessary fillers. When I choose carefully and stay consistent, I usually see a healthier coat and less loose fur around the house.
